Poland township is located in Mahoning County, Ohio. Poland township has a 2025 population of 14,442. Poland township is currently declining at a rate of -0.13% annually and its population has decreased by -1.25%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 14,625 in 2020.
The average household income in Poland township is $119,867 with a poverty rate of 5.17%.The median age in Poland township is 46.2 years: 45.2 years for males, and 47.3 years for females.

The racial composition of Poland township includes 94.33% White, and smaller percentages for Black or African American, other race, Asian and multiracial populations.
Race | Population | Percentage (of total) |
---|---|---|
White | 13,743 | 94.33% |
Two or more races | 453 | 3.11% |
Black or African American | 185 | 1.27% |
Other race | 147 | 1.01% |
Asian | 41 | 0.28% |

Poland township's average per capita income is $55,884. Household income levels show a median of $94,101. The poverty rate stands at 5.17%.
Name | Median | Mean |
---|---|---|
Married Families | $117,341 | - |
Families | $110,331 | $136,969 |
Households | $94,101 | $119,867 |
Non Families | $51,850 | $72,382 |
